I understand some meetings are very open to addicts, but my area is pretty cut and dry. There are cross-addicted people, of course, but in AA they identify as alcoholic and they share about alcoholism. There is not a lot of talk about drugs in the meetings where I live. You'll hear it more in speaker meetings, but even then the speaker most times will say something about drugs being apart of the story, but they're focusing the talk on alcoholism.

I have also been to a few NA meetings. Occasionally we do get visitors from NA in AA--one guy goes mostly to NA, but also identifies as alcoholic, and shares at AA meetings. I have gotten something out of his shares, no doubt.
